Railroad Injuries Lawsuits

You may be able to sue your railroad company if you have been injured on the job. The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A) allows you to file claims against a railroad in the event that it can be proved that negligence caused your injuries.

The FELA procedure is a complicated one, but a knowledgeable railroad injury lawyer can guide you through it. It requires extensive discovery and may include expert testimony.

Additionally, if were injured on the job as a railroad worker you may be able to file a lawsuit against your employer for negligence under the Federal Employers' Liability Act (FELA). A FELA claim requires you to demonstrate that your employer has violated the FELA and caused your injuries.

Fortunately, FELA is more flexible than other laws governing workers' compensation. It doesn't require that an injured worker prove they were completely responsible for their injuries. A railroad employee may have a case based on "comparative negligence."

This means that you can take action against the railroad, even in the event that you are partially at fault for your injuries. You will be entitled to compensation for all of your damages, including any loss of earnings as well as pain and suffering and mental or physical anguish. You can also recover your future earnings, as well as any other losses you may have suffered due to your injuries.
